电商数据库如何实现精准用户画像分析?
电商平台数据库
随着互联网技术的飞速发展,电商平台已成为现代商业不可或缺的一部分,电商平台数据库作为支撑电商平台运营的核心,承担着存储、管理、分析和处理海量数据的重要任务,本文将从电商平台数据库的定义、特点、类型及构建等方面进行详细阐述。
一、定义
电商平台数据库是指用于存储、管理和处理电商平台各类数据的系统,它涵盖了商品信息、用户信息、订单信息、支付信息、物流信息等多个方面,为电商平台提供全面的数据支持。
二、特点
1、海量数据:电商平台涉及的用户、商品、订单等数据量巨大,对数据库的存储和处理能力提出了较高要求。
2、实时性:电商平台数据库需要实时响应用户操作,保证数据的准确性和时效性。
3、安全性:电商平台数据库涉及用户隐私和商业机密,需要具备较高的安全性。
4、可扩展性:随着业务的发展,电商平台数据库需要具备良好的可扩展性,以满足不断增长的数据需求。
三、类型
1、关系型数据库:如MySQL、Oracle等,以表格形式存储数据,便于查询和管理。
2、非关系型数据库:如MongoDB、Redis等,以文档、键值对等形式存储数据,适用于大规模、高并发的场景。
3、分布式数据库:如HBase、Cassandra等,将数据分散存储在多个节点上,提高数据处理的性能和可靠性。
四、构建
1、需求分析:根据电商平台业务需求,确定数据库类型、存储结构、功能模块等。
2、数据库设计:根据需求分析结果,设计数据库表结构、字段、索引等。
3、数据导入:将现有数据导入到数据库中,确保数据的完整性和准确性。
4、系统优化:对数据库进行性能优化,提高查询速度和稳定性。
电商平台数据库应用案例
以下列举几个电商平台数据库的应用案例:
案例名称 | 数据库类型 | 应用场景 |
淘宝网 | MySQL | 存储商品信息、用户信息、订单信息等 |
京东 | MongoDB | 存储商品信息、用户信息、订单信息等 |
拼多多 | Redis | 缓存商品信息、用户信息、订单信息等 |
相关问题与解答
问题一:电商平台数据库与普通数据库有何区别?
解答:电商平台数据库与普通数据库相比,具有海量数据、实时性、安全性和可扩展性等特点,以满足电商平台对数据处理的特殊需求。
问题二:如何保证电商平台数据库的安全性?
解答:为了保证电商平台数据库的安全性,可以采取以下措施:
1、数据加密:对敏感数据进行加密存储,防止数据泄露。
2、访问控制:设置合理的用户权限,限制对数据库的访问。
3、定期备份:定期备份数据库,防止数据丢失。
4、安全审计:对数据库访问进行审计,及时发现异常行为。
以上内容就是解答有关“电商平台数据库”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。
暂无评论,1人围观